Reputation for Poker:

The beginnings of poker tend to be thought to date back again to the early nineteenth century in the usa. It developed from different card games like Primero and Brelan, incorporating elements of wagering and bluffing. The video game distribute quickly across the Mississippi River, with different variants appearing with time. These days, poker has grown to become a global phenomenon, with professional tournaments and committed on line platforms attracting scores of people.

Rules of Poker:

Poker is normally played with a regular deck of 52 cards. The objective should win the cooking pot, which is the amount of cash or potato chips positioned in the middle of the dining table. Each player is dealt a set range cards and must utilize their particular skills to really make the most effective hand or bluff their opponents into folding. The most typical variations of poker consist of texas hold em, Omaha, and Seven-Card Stud, each making use of their own unique guidelines and game play.

Poker Variants:

Texas holdem is one of popular variant of poker, played both in everyday games and professional tournaments. People are dealt two personal cards and must develop the best hand possible using a variety of these cards and five shared community cards. Omaha is comparable to texas holdem but people obtain four exclusive cards. Seven-Card Stud, however, involves each player receiving seven cards, plus the objective would be to result in the most useful hand making use of any five of them.
